National Hookah Community Association NHCA is dedicated to protecting & preserving ho**ah culture and businesses across the United States.

We promote and protect the interests of many thousands of businesses that make or sell a part of the unique social & cultural experience that is ho**ah Mission:

The NHCA is committed supporting and defending its members by:

- Promoting understanding of the culture, community and business of ho**ah to society and politicians
- Protecting ho**ah from regulation that threatens the ho**ah economi

c and social community.
- Working with law makers to support regulation that supports good practices and high standards in our sector. Our culture and our sector are at risk, usually from legislation targeting the misdeeds of giant multinational companies selling very different products to ours. Until NHCA was formed, ho**ah was one of the few business sectors in the United States that was not represented in political decision making by a trade association.

NHCA Member Update

Welcome to your latest member update from NHCA!

As we begin the new year, NHCA’s Board was reelected to another 2-year term. Chris Hudgins with Al Fakher was elected to serve as NHCA’s President with former President Arnie Abramyan remaining on the board along with Rima Khoury serving as Secretary and George Jonson as Treasurer. Neeve Donoghue will continue to serve as Outreach Coordinator. The entire Board looks forward to another year of saving ho**ah.

After a very successful 2023 where we stopped ho**ah bans in Connecticut, Hawaii, Indiana, Maine, Maryland, Minnesota, Nevada, New Jersey, New Mexico, New York, Ohio, Oregon, Pennsylvania, Texas, Vermont, Washington State and several cities, we are back at it for 2024.

So far, Colorado, Hawaii, Indiana, Maine, Michigan, Minnesota, New Jersey, New Mexico, Pennsylvania, Vermont and Washington State have all indicated they will be considering bans on flavored ho**ah in 2024. We need your help and support as we continue to fight to **ah.

Re: Honolulu, HI (Population 345,510)

The city of Honolulu will consider a first reading on a draft ordinance to include the following:
Flavor ban that would apply to all traditional to***co, v***r, and modern oral products.
Does not ban the flavor of to***co
Applies to zero nic, synthetic nic, and WS3 products
Prohibits the mislabeling or marketing of any e-liquid product as ni****ne free if it contains ni****ne.
Penalties
$1000 fine and an additional fine of $2000 per day for each day the violation persists beyond first violation.
For a recurring violation, a fine of $2000 and an additional fine of $5000 per day for each day the violation persists.
Effective 42 days after the State preemption of county ordinances is officially repealed or suspended.

Great News in Ohio:

Ohio State lawmakers passed a bill (House Bill 513) that preempts Ohio cities and counties from passing flavored to***co bans. The ten day period that Governor DeWine could veto the bill has expired and now it has become law. This means that ho**ah is safe in the entire state of Ohio. **ah
